The Latest Largey Adventure!

We decided we didn't want to be bored on Martin Luther King day so we scheduled an adventure with our friends, the Turleys. We packed up the car, picked up Turley's and headed up North to Logan, UT! First stop there was the Gossner Cheese factory where we sampled flavored milks, cheese dips and of course, SQUEAKY CHEESE!



Hyrum's favorite part of the trip was snacking on all the cheese he could eat and all the cookies and cream milk he could drink! :)

Next stop was the Willow park zoo where it was cold but the animals were out in the weather so we got to see eagles, bobcats, coyotes, elk, lots of different birds, ducks and peacocks, even porcipines and wallabyes!


This is the boy's impression of a crane. :)


The California surfer ducks


For lunch we stopped at the Blue Bird cafe and candy shop- it was delicious! I recommend it for the food and the atmosphere!


Here's the family at the Logan temple- it was closed for cleaning but it is one beautiful building.


Weston, Hyrum, Josiah and Avery- silly kids, great travellers!


We decided it was worth the short drive up to Preston to see the Napoleon Dynamite sites... This street has the Cuttin' Corral, King's (where they buy chips and Markers with Uncle Rico) and the DI where he finds his suit...Sweet.

Oh, it's Pedro's house all right! Anyone want to go over some sweet jumps on a bike?


And Napoleon's very own house- it really is out in the country with nothing around except fields. Of course we had to go home and watch the movie again to see all the places we visited- now we can say "Hey, I've been there!" :)
